The process starts by browsing listings and saving profiles that match your lifestyle. Strong matches usually share clear notes on health, energy level, house manners, and tolerance for kids or other pets. After you choose a few candidates, you complete applications that request references, landlord approval if you rent, and a brief description of your daily routine. Many groups schedule meet-and-greets with all household members so everyone observes behavior in a calm setting. Home checks may be virtual or in person to confirm safe fencing, secure trash storage, and a quiet rest area for the dog.
Approval timelines vary in Kansas, though most adoptions move from application to decision within 3 to 10 days when paperwork and scheduling go smoothly. Some foster-based groups move faster if a dog already meets your criteria and your references respond quickly. If your match lives in another city, rescues sometimes arrange transport between locations. Transport is often arranged by rescues to move dogs between states or regions using volunteer drivers or licensed carriers who follow safety protocols and meet at agreed pickup points. Once approved, you sign an adoption contract, pay the fee, and receive medical records along with transition tips for the first week at home.

How Much Does It Cost to Adopt a Cairn Terrier in Kansas?In Kansas, most adult Cairn Terriers adopted through shelters or rescues cost $175 to $350, while puppies usually range from $300 to $500. Fees reflect age, demand for small terriers, and the level of veterinary care provided before placement. Costs commonly include spaying or neutering, vaccinations, microchipping, and veterinary exams. Prices may be higher for dogs that receive dental cleanings, specialty medications, or extra training. Modest transport fees can apply when a group coordinates travel to bring a dog to your area. |
How Should I Train a Cairn Terrier?Cairn Terriers are smart, alert, and independent. They learn quickly when sessions stay short, upbeat, and predictable. Use positive reinforcement with food, play, and praise to reward calm choices and clear cues. Practice leash manners, polite greetings, and impulse control games that build focus around distractions. A reliable recall, a relaxed settle, and a go-to-place cue help terriers channel energy into productive behaviors. Expect curious digging, quick chasing, and occasional barking. Give legal outlets for these instincts by using scent games, food puzzles, and a designated dig area. Reward quiet moments, teach a leave-it cue, and rotate toys to prevent boredom. Consistency matters more than intensity, so train a little every day.
